Question -
Found 2001 D Dime that looks like an error was made in making Dime.  Copper middle looks like it's eroding.  Any help on this.

Thanks
Dave Parr

Answer -
Hi David,

Your coin sounds like it is missing the outer clad layer.  The weight should be under the usual weight for this coin and it should be a nice copper color.  This is a type of error that needs to be seen to tell exactly what it is.
